A law firm in Boston, MA is seeking a Pre-Litigation Attorney responsible for overseeing all aspects of personal injury cases up to the filing of a complaint. The ideal candidate will have strong negotiation skills, leadership abilities, and a commitment to providing exceptional client service.

 

Duties:

  • Supervise and provide direction to a team of staff members
  • Evaluate the merits of personal injury cases
  • Provide guidance and counsel to clients
  • Conduct medical case reviews
  • Conduct research and legal analysis
  • Negotiate and authorize settlements in the pre-litigation stage

 

Requirements:

  • A license in good standing to practice law in Massachusetts
  • 2+ years of experience with client contact and/or negotiation experience

 

Education & Certifications:

Juris Doctor (JD) degree from an accredited law school

 

Skills:

  • Strong research, verbal, and written communication skills
  • Ability to handle a large and active caseload
  • Prioritization of client representation and customer service
  • Excellent investigator and problem-solving skills
  • Success providing direction and guidance to a team
  • Formidable negotiation skills

 

Benefits:

  • Paid Time Off (PTO) plus 8 paid holidays
  • Bonuses
  • Medical Benefits (Health, Dental, Vision, STD & LTD, and other medical coverages)
  • Group and Optional Life insurance
  • Employee Assistance Programs
  • 401(k) with company matching
